News of Reginald’s passing swept across Harboridge City, making headlines and stirring up quite the storm among the city’s elite.

The White family was a powerhouse—not just in Harboridge, but throughout the entire business world. Years ago, Reginald had married into the family with nothing, yet somehow clawed his way to the very top. His cunning and ruthlessness were legendary.

Back when the city’s four great families were battered by financial crises and brutal infighting, every one of them took a hit. The Lynches were even teetering on the edge of bankruptcy. But despite losing his only son, daughter-in-law, and granddaughter in one tragic stroke, Reginald still managed to keep the White Corporation afloat. That alone spoke volumes about his shrewdness.

But he didn’t stop there. Reginald singlehandedly pulled the Lynch Corporation back from the brink, rescuing them when everyone else had given up hope.

***

White Manor.

“We have to make sure the funeral arrangements are flawless. The wake should last seven days, just like they do back in Reginald’s hometown, with a reception for guests each night. Clayton, you and Coco will need to be present for every ceremony—it’ll be exhausting, but it’s tradition.” Mr. Brown stood in the parlor, giving instructions to Alicia and Clayton about the memorial.

He paused, voice lowering. “And… after Reginald’s death, Brandon and Jade received nothing. No inheritance, no shares. You can bet they won’t take that lying down. They’ll be here to cause trouble, trying to stir up a scandal for the press. Be ready for them—don’t give them any ammunition.” With that, Mr. Brown hurried off to oversee the rest of the preparations.

Alicia understood what he meant. If she kept Brandon and Jade from paying their respects, they’d play the victims for the cameras, claiming she was barring them from honoring their own grandfather.

“Miss Alicia, Brandon and Jade are back,” the butler reported, looking apologetic. “They’re making a scene at the gate. We can’t just throw them out, and even the police say it’s a family matter…”

“You’ve done enough. Go look after the guests—I’ll handle this.” Alicia nodded and, flanked by her bodyguards, walked toward the manor’s entrance.
